BACKGROUND:

Mr. Timothy Casey holds B.S. and M.S. degrees in Mechanical Engineering and is a registered professional engineer in Florida, Georgia, Alabama, North Carolina, and South Carolina. He is accredited as an accident reconstructionist by the Accreditation Commission for Traffic Accident Reconstruction.

He has experience in machine design for a wide variety of mechanical assemblies, heating, ventilation, and air conditioning (HVAC) load analysis, HVAC performance issues, mold issues, plumbing products, propane and natural gas components and systems, laser safety system standards, oxygen storage tank inspection, piping assembly design for gas turbines, pipe support design for welded structures, failure analysis of consumer products, computer numeric controlled (CNC) equipment, wood wall and ceiling panel installation, high-speed aerodynamic testing, mechanical systems and equipment, industrial machinery, and failure analysis of consumer products.

Mr. Casey has over 14 years of experience in vehicle accident reconstruction, vehicle inspections, mechanical design of consumer and military products, industrial machinery, gas turbine piping, and construction. His area of expertise includes the investigation, analysis, and reconstruction of vehicle collisions including damage analysis, coefficient of friction of roadways, and vehicle lamp examinations.

Mr. Casey is trained in digital site mapping, passenger and commercial vehicle inspection, reconstruction of accidents involving pedestrians, bicycles, and motorcycles, and the collection and analysis of event data recorder information from passenger vehicles.

Mr. Casey has experience in marine forensic engineering services including the mechanical evaluation of marine components, manufacturing defect claims, and accident cause and origin investigations.
